对象存储oss流量包,深度解析对象存储流式上传技术,优化数据传输,提升云存储效率
- 综合资讯
- 2024-11-27 09:51:42
- 2

深度解析对象存储流式上传技术,针对oss流量包优化数据传输,有效提升云存储效率。...
深度解析对象存储流式上传技术,针对oss流量包优化数据传输,有效提升云存储效率。
随着互联网技术的飞速发展,大数据时代已经到来,数据量呈指数级增长,如何高效、安全地存储和传输海量数据成为企业关注的焦点,对象存储(Object Storage)作为一种新型的云存储解决方案,以其高效、安全、可扩展的特点,在云计算领域得到了广泛应用,而流式上传作为对象存储的关键技术之一,能够极大地优化数据传输过程,提高云存储效率,本文将深入解析对象存储流式上传技术,帮助读者全面了解其原理、优势和应用场景。
对象存储流式上传原理
1、对象存储基本概念
对象存储是一种基于文件系统的分布式存储架构,将数据存储为对象,每个对象由唯一标识符(ID)、元数据和对象内容组成,与传统存储方式相比,对象存储具有以下特点:
(1)数据结构简单,易于扩展;
(2)支持海量数据存储;
(3)可支持多种访问协议,如HTTP、HTTPS等;
(4)具备良好的安全性。
2、流式上传原理
流式上传是指将数据以流的形式,边读取边上传到对象存储的过程,在流式上传过程中,数据不再以完整文件的形式传输,而是以数据块为单位进行传输,具体步骤如下:
(1)客户端将数据分割成多个数据块;
(2)客户端将数据块依次发送到对象存储服务器;
(3)对象存储服务器接收数据块,并存储到对应的存储节点上;
(4)数据块上传完成后,客户端向对象存储服务器发送数据块信息,包括数据块ID、大小、顺序等;
(5)对象存储服务器根据数据块信息,组装完整的数据对象,并存储到存储系统中。
对象存储流式上传优势
1、提高数据传输效率
流式上传将数据分割成多个数据块,可以充分利用网络带宽,提高数据传输效率,在数据传输过程中,可以并行上传多个数据块,进一步优化传输速度。
2、降低网络延迟
流式上传允许客户端边读取边上传数据,避免了数据读取完成后进行上传,从而降低了网络延迟。
3、提高存储系统稳定性
流式上传将数据分割成多个数据块,可以在上传过程中,对数据块进行校验,确保数据完整性,当某个数据块上传失败时,可以重新上传该数据块,提高存储系统的稳定性。
4、适用于海量数据传输
流式上传适用于海量数据传输场景,如大数据、云盘、视频点播等,在传输海量数据时,流式上传能够有效提高传输效率,降低网络压力。
对象存储流式上传应用场景
1、大数据存储
在大数据领域,流式上传可以高效地将海量数据存储到对象存储系统中,提高数据处理效率。
2、云盘
流式上传适用于云盘数据传输,可以实现边上传边使用,提高用户体验。
3、视频点播
在视频点播场景中,流式上传可以将视频文件分割成多个数据块,提高视频传输效率,降低用户等待时间。
4、在线教育
在线教育平台可以利用流式上传技术,实现课程资源的快速上传和分发,提高教学效率。
对象存储流式上传技术作为一种高效、安全的云存储解决方案,在数据传输、存储和分发等领域具有广泛的应用前景,通过深入解析流式上传原理、优势和应用场景,有助于我们更好地理解和应用这一技术,为企业和个人提供更优质、高效的云存储服务,随着云计算技术的不断发展,流式上传技术将会在更多领域得到应用,为我国云计算产业注入新的活力。
本文链接:https://www.zhitaoyun.cn/1118546.html
发表评论